How To Unpack Enigma Protector Better Extra Quality

Use an automated file extractor like evbunpack to pull files out of the virtual layer first.

Use file optimization tools to realign sections, trim broken alignment padding, and verify that PE headers accurately reflect the new uncompressed structural reality of your binary on disk.

LCF-AT or SHADOW_UA scripts from community forums like Tuts4You x64dbg scripts for bypassing Enigma's hardware ID checks? mos9527/evbunpack: Enigma Virtual Box Unpacker ... - GitHub

Before diving into tools and techniques, let us briefly review the protection features Enigma Protector offers. Understanding the enemy is half the battle won. how to unpack enigma protector better

Set breakpoints on common APIs used during the unpacking transition, such as VirtualAlloc GetModuleHandleA Advanced versions of Enigma use Virtual Machine (VM) protection

Many Enigma-protected files are locked to specific hardware. You must identify and patch the HWID check within the code or use a script (such as those by LCF-AT) to fake a valid hardware ID. 3. Locate the Original Entry Point (OEP) Finding where the real application code begins is critical. Shadow Tactics:

: If Scylla marks several entries as "Invalid," Enigma is using API emulation. You must follow these invalid pointers in the debugger's disassembly window to see which real API function they jump to, manually resolve them, and then click Fix Dump on your extracted file to sew the clean IAT directly into the executable header. 5. Handle Virtualization and Stripping Residual Sections Use an automated file extractor like evbunpack to

Some developers use multiple packers in combination. For instance, one developer was "using main one Enigma packer, some dll VMP ultimate, some themida/winlicense". In such cases, you must unpack in layers:

If you are reading this, you have probably encountered a real-world need to unpack an Enigma-protected file, or you are studying reverse engineering and want to improve your skills. Either way, this comprehensive guide will walk you through the entire process, from gathering the right tools to understanding advanced manual techniques. By the end, you will have a clear roadmap for unpacking Enigma Protector more effectively—whether you are a seasoned professional or an enthusiastic learner.

Enigma may redirect you to a – a code block that re-encrypts memory if a debugger is detected. Always verify the OEP by stepping 5–10 instructions. If you see INT 3 , IN , OUT , or PUSHAD / POPAD pairs, you are in a virtualized or fake block. mos9527/evbunpack: Enigma Virtual Box Unpacker

To bypass HWID:

Hook ( NtQueryInformationProcess , OutputDebugString ). 2. Handle Exception Filtering

Navigate to the debugger options and set a breakpoint on or the system entry point.

Uso de cookies

Este sitio web utiliza cookies para que usted tenga la mejor experiencia de usuario. Si continúa navegando está dando su consentimiento para la aceptación de las mencionadas cookies y la aceptación de nuestra política de cookies, pinche el enlace para mayor información.plugin cookies

ACEPTAR
Aviso de cookies